Canvas Prints till Vardagsrummet
The living room is the gallery of your home - the wall above the sofa is the artwork you see most often. Choose a confident statement: a sweeping landscape that pulls the eye in, an abstract that charges a neutral palette, or a city skyline for a modern interior. Above a three-seat sofa we recommend a canvas between 60x90 and 100x150 cm, leaving 15-20 cm clearance to the cushions.

Modern Canvas Prints for the Living Room
Modern living rooms read best with a limited palette and one clear focal point. Abstract compositions in muted grey, sand and terracotta sit comfortably beside wood and linen, while geometric and mixed-media work brings structure to an open-plan space without adding noise. When the room already has strong architecture, pick a single hero canvas rather than a gallery wall.
Large Canvas Prints Above the Sofa
The most common sizing mistake is going too small. A canvas should span roughly two-thirds to three-quarters of the sofa width: 120-150 cm above a 180 cm sofa. If a single piece at that scale feels heavy, a five-panel set covers the same width in a lighter, more open composition.
